3 x 5 mm TCVCXO
Description:
The TV105A
Temperature
Compensated Voltage
Controllable Crystal
Oscillator (TCVCXO)
Series products provide a
wide range of options in
temperature stability,
operating frequency
range, and electronic
frequency adjustment in
a miniature 3 x 5 mm
ceramic SMD package.
TV105A Series
Features:
Available in frequencies from
10 to 40 MHz with 13 MHz,
14.4 MHz, 20 MHz, and other
frequencies as standards
+/-5 to +/- 20 ppm pull range
Clipped Sine Wave output
Standard 3 x 5 mm ceramic
SMD package
RoHS-6 Lead-free compliant
